  1. I-a disease in which donor bone marrow attacks host
    I-Graft-versus-Host Disease (GVHD)
  2. N-allergen causes an allergy (e.g. latex, peanuts)
    N-Type I Hypersensitivity
  3. N-identical twin to twin organ graft
    N-isograft
  4. B-introducing small portions of allergen in prescribed time intervals
    B-desensitization
  5. G-ex. of organ-specific autoimmune diseases
    G-Celiac disease, Type I diabetes
  6. N-reaction during PPST in presence of allergen
    N-wheal-flare reaction
  7. G-ex. of secondary immuno-deficiency
    G-Acquired Immuno-deficiency Syndrome (AIDS)
  8. B-characterized by specificity and memory
    B-adaptive immune system
  9. I-self to self organ graft
    I-autograft
  10. I-recognizes pathogens through PRRs by PAMPs
    I-innate immune system
  11. G-release of inflammatory molecules by mast cells (e.g. histamine)
    G-degranulation
  12. I-ex. of localized allergic reaction
    I-hives, hay fever, asthma
  13. B-ex. of systemic allergic reaction
    B-anaphylaxis
  14. G-ex. of an antihistamine
    G-Benadryl
  15. G-individual to individual organ graft
    G-allograft
  16. N-ex. of primary immuno-deficiency
    N-Severe Combined Immuno-deficiency (SCID)
  17. I-adrenaline used to counteract allergic reactions
    I-epinephrine
  18. B-ex. of systemic autoimmune diseases
    B-Multiple Sclerosis, Rheumatoid Arthritis
  19. N-lack of anti-self immune response
    N-immune tolerance
  20. B-animal to human organ graft
    B-xenograft
